The ABCs of Computer Networks: A Simple Guide for Beginners

In an increasingly interconnected world, understanding the fundamental principles of computer networks is no longer just for IT professionals. From streaming your favorite shows to conducting global business, networks are the invisible threads that weave our digital lives together. This comprehensive guide will demystify the complexities of computer networks, offering an accessible entry point for beginners and a deeper dive into their various facets.

Understanding the Basics of Computer Networks

At its core, a computer network is a collection of interconnected computing devices that can exchange data and share resources. Imagine a group of people in a room, all able to talk to each other and pass notes around. In this analogy, the people are devices (computers, printers, smartphones), and the conversations or notes are data being exchanged. The primary purpose of a network is to facilitate this communication and resource sharing, leading to increased efficiency and collaboration.

The Fundamental Elements of Communication

For any communication to happen, several key elements must be present. First, there’s the sender, the device initiating the communication. Then, there’s the receiver, the device destined to receive the data. The information itself is the message, which could be anything from a simple text file to a complex video stream. To ensure the message arrives correctly, a set of rules, known as protocols, govern the communication. Furthermore, a transmission medium is required to carry the message, analogous to the air carrying sound waves or a road carrying vehicles. This medium can be physical, like cables, or wireless, like radio waves.

How Data Travels Across a Network

When you send an email, it doesn’t travel as one giant block. Instead, it’s broken down into smaller, manageable chunks called packets. Each packet contains a portion of the data along with header information, including the sender’s and receiver’s addresses. These packets then scurry across the network independently, often taking different paths, like individual cars on a highway. Once they arrive at their destination, they are reassembled in the correct order to reconstruct the original message. This packet-switching technique is highly efficient and resilient, as even if one path is blocked, the packets can find alternative routes.

Types of Computer Networks: A Comprehensive Overview

Networks come in various shapes and sizes, each designed for specific purposes and geographical scopes. Understanding these distinctions is crucial for appreciating the vastness and versatility of network technology.

Local Area Networks (LANs)

A Local Area Network (LAN) connects devices within a relatively small, confined geographical area, such as a home, office building, or school campus. Think of your home Wi-Fi network – that’s a classic example of a LAN. LANs typically offer high data transfer rates and are owned and managed by a single organization or individual. They enable devices to share resources like printers, scanners, and internet connections, fostering a collaborative environment within a localized space.

Wide Area Networks (WANs)

Spanning larger geographical areas, from cities to entire continents, are Wide Area Networks (WANs). The most prominent example of a WAN is the internet itself. WANs connect multiple LANs, allowing for communication and data exchange across vast distances. Unlike LANs, WANs often rely on public telecommunications infrastructure, such as fiber optic cables, satellite links, and cellular networks. They are essential for global businesses, interconnected government agencies, and the worldwide web as we know it.

Other Significant Network Types

Beyond LANs and WANs, several other network types cater to specialized needs. A Metropolitan Area Network (MAN) covers an area larger than a LAN but smaller than a WAN, typically a city or large campus. It often connects multiple LANs within that area. Personal Area Networks (PANs), on the other hand, are the smallest networks, connecting devices around a single person, such as a Bluetooth headset paired with a smartphone. Finally, Storage Area Networks (SANs) are dedicated networks primarily designed to provide high-speed access to shared data storage devices, crucial for data centers and large enterprises.

The Importance of Computer Networks in Today’s World

It’s hard to overstate the impact and importance of computer networks in our modern society. They are the backbone of virtually every aspect of our digital lives, driving innovation, facilitating communication, and shaping the global economy.

Enabling Global Communication and Collaboration

Networks have collapsed geographical barriers, making instantaneous communication and collaboration across continents a reality. From video conferencing with international colleagues to instant messaging with friends and family worldwide, networks foster unprecedented levels of interconnectedness. This has profound implications for global business, education, and social interaction, promoting diverse perspectives and shared understanding.

Driving Economic Growth and Innovation

The internet, the ultimate network, has fueled entirely new industries and business models. E-commerce, cloud computing, and social media platforms are just a few examples of sectors that wouldn’t exist without ubiquitous network access. Networks facilitate supply chain management, data analysis, and remote work, leading to increased productivity and efficiency across all industries. They are also critical for research and development, allowing scientists and innovators to share data and collaborate on groundbreaking discoveries.

Access to Information and Entertainment

The sheer volume of information available at our fingertips today is a direct result of interconnected networks. News, educational resources, research papers, and creative content are all just a click away. Furthermore, networks power the vast entertainment industry, enabling streaming services, online gaming, and digital content distribution, transforming how we consume media and spend our leisure time.

Key Components of a Computer Network

To build and operate a network, several essential hardware and software components work in harmony. Understanding these components is crucial for anyone looking to set up or troubleshoot a network.

Network Hardware Essentials

At the physical layer, devices like routers act as traffic cops, directing data packets between different networks. They intelligently decide the best path for data to travel. Switches, on the other hand, connect multiple devices within the same network, efficiently directing data to the intended recipient. A modem translates signals from your internet service provider (ISP) into a format your router can understand, acting as the gateway to the wider internet. Then there are network interface cards (NICs), which are hardware components within devices that allow them to connect to a network, whether wired or wireless. Finally, cables, such as Ethernet cables, provide the physical medium for data transmission in wired networks.

Network Software and Protocols

Beyond the physical hardware, software is equally vital. Network operating systems (NOS) manage network resources, user access, and security. Protocols are sets of rules that govern how data is formatted, transmitted, and received. Key protocols include TCP/IP (Transmission Control Protocol/Internet Protocol), the foundation of the internet, which ensures reliable data delivery and addressing. HTTP (Hypertext Transfer Protocol) is used for accessing web pages, while FTP (File Transfer Protocol) facilitates file transfers. These protocols ensure seamless communication between diverse devices and systems across the network.

How to Set Up a Basic Computer Network

Setting up a basic network, especially for a home or small office, is now more straightforward than ever before. Here’s a simplified guide to get you started.

Planning Your Network Layout

Before even touching any equipment, consider your needs. How many devices will connect? Where will they be located? Do you primarily need wired or wireless connectivity? Sketching out a simple diagram of your space and where devices will be is a helpful first step. Identify potential signal dead zones for Wi-Fi and consider where power outlets are located.

Connecting Your Devices

The typical setup starts with your modem, connected to your ISP’s line. Then, connect your router to the modem via an Ethernet cable. Your computers, printers, and other devices can then connect to the router, either wirelessly via Wi-Fi or directly with Ethernet cables. For wired connections, simply plug one end of an Ethernet cable into your device’s NIC and the other into an available port on your router. For wireless, you’ll typically find the Wi-Fi network name (SSID) and a password on the router itself, or in the accompanying documentation.

Configuring Network Settings

Once connected, you may need to configure some basic settings. Most modern routers have a web-based interface accessible through a web browser by typing in the router’s IP address (often found on a sticker on the router). Here, you can change the Wi-Fi name and password, set up guest networks, and configure security settings. It’s crucial to change the default admin password for your router to prevent unauthorized access. Always enable strong encryption like WPA2 or WPA3 for your wireless network.

Common Issues and Troubleshooting in Computer Networks

Even the most robust networks can encounter issues. Knowing how to identify and address common problems can save you considerable frustration.

Diagnosing Connectivity Problems

“No internet” is a common complaint. Start by checking the physical connections: are all cables securely plugged in? Look at the indicator lights on your modem and router; they often provide visual cues about their status. A blinking light might indicate data activity, while a solid red light usually signals a problem. Try restarting your modem and router; often, a simple reboot can resolve temporary glitches. If the problem persists, try connecting directly to the modem with a single device to isolate whether the issue is with your router or the internet service itself.

Addressing Slow Network Performance

Slow internet or network data transfer can be due to various factors. Bandwidth congestion occurs when too many devices are simultaneously using the network, especially for demanding tasks like streaming or gaming. Consider upgrading your internet plan or reducing the number of active devices. Weak Wi-Fi signals can also be a culprit, particularly in larger homes or areas with obstacles. Repositioning your router, using Wi-Fi extenders, or upgrading to a mesh Wi-Fi system can improve signal strength. Outdated or faulty network drivers on your devices can also impact performance, so ensure they are up to date.

Security Concerns and Solutions

Network security is paramount. Unauthorized access can occur if your Wi-Fi password is weak or your router’s default login credentials haven’t been changed. Use strong, unique passwords for both. Malware and viruses can compromise networked devices, so always use reputable antivirus software and firewalls. Phishing attempts and suspicious links can lead to credential theft, so exercise caution when opening emails or clicking on unfamiliar websites. Regularly updating your router’s firmware is also crucial, as manufacturers often release updates to patch security vulnerabilities.

The Future of Computer Networks: Emerging Technologies and Trends

The landscape of computer networks is constantly evolving, driven by innovation and the ever-increasing demand for faster, more reliable, and more intelligent connectivity.

5G and Beyond: Transforming Wireless Connectivity

The rollout of 5G technology is revolutionizing wireless communication, promising significantly faster speeds, lower latency, and greater capacity than previous generations. This will unlock new possibilities for mobile broadband, the Internet of Things (IoT), and applications requiring real-time responsiveness, such as autonomous vehicles and remote surgery. The advancements beyond 5G, often referred to as “6G,” are already being researched, aiming for even more immersive experiences and deeper integration of AI.

The Rise of IoT and Edge Computing

The Internet of Things (IoT), where everyday objects are embedded with sensors and connected to the internet, is generating an unprecedented volume of data. To process this data efficiently and reduce latency, edge computing is gaining prominence. Edge computing processes data closer to its source, rather than sending it all to a centralized cloud. This distributed approach reduces bandwidth usage, enhances real-time decision-making, and improves privacy for sensitive data generated by IoT devices.

Network Automation and AI Integration

Managing complex networks manually is becoming increasingly challenging. Network automation, powered by artificial intelligence (AI) and machine learning (ML), is emerging as a solution. AI can analyze network traffic patterns, predict potential issues, and even self-heal the network by automatically configuring devices and optimizing performance. This shift towards intelligent, self-managing networks will reduce operational costs, enhance reliability, and free up human administrators to focus on more strategic tasks. The future of networks promises a dynamic, responsive, and highly interconnected world, continuously adapting to our evolving needs.

FAQs

1. What is a computer network?

A computer network is a collection of interconnected devices, such as computers, printers, and servers, that can communicate and share resources with each other. This communication can be wired or wireless, and it allows for the sharing of data, information, and resources among the connected devices.

2. What are the different types of computer networks?

There are several types of computer networks, including local area networks (LANs), which are confined to a small geographic area; wide area networks (WANs), which connect devices over a larger geographic area; and wireless networks, which use radio waves to connect devices without the need for physical cables.

3. What are the key components of a computer network?

The key components of a computer network include devices such as computers, routers, switches, and access points, as well as the cables, wireless signals, and protocols that enable communication between these devices. Additionally, network software and security measures are essential components of a computer network.

4. How do you set up a basic computer network?

Setting up a basic computer network involves connecting devices using cables or wireless connections, configuring network settings on each device, and ensuring that the devices can communicate with each other. This may also involve setting up a router or switch to manage the network traffic and provide internet access.

5. What are some common issues and troubleshooting methods in computer networks?

Common issues in computer networks include slow network speeds, connectivity problems, and security breaches. Troubleshooting methods may involve checking physical connections, resetting network devices, updating software and firmware, and implementing security measures such as firewalls and encryption.

Leave a Reply

Your email address will not be published. Required fields are marked *